From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ia Leonardo Cimino (November 4, 1917 - March 3, 2012) was an Italian film, television and stage actor who in 1937 appeared in the original stage production of Marc Blitzstein's "The Cradle Will Rock." Leonardo's most well-known roles were in the 1983 science fiction miniseries, "V," as Abraham Bernstein and the 1987 feature film "The Monster Squad," as the "scary German guy." Cimino made guest appearances on TV shows, including "Naked City," "Kojak," "The Equalizer" and "Law & Order." Cimino was married to actress Sharon Powers.
